Permissions-Policy : directive payment
Disponibilité limitée
Cette fonctionnalité n'est pas Compatible car elle ne fonctionne pas dans certains des navigateurs les plus utilisés.
Want more support for this feature? Tell us why.
Expérimental: Il s'agit d'une technologie expérimentale.
Vérifiez attentivement le tableau de compatibilité des navigateurs avant de l'utiliser en production.
L'en-tête HTTP Permissions-Policy avec la directive payment contrôle si le document actuel est autorisé à utiliser l'API Payment Request.
Plus précisément, lorsqu'une politique définie bloque l'utilisation, les appels au constructeur PaymentRequest() lèvent une DOMException de type SecurityError.
Syntaxe
Permissions-Policy: payment=<allowlist>;
<allowlist>-
Une liste d'origines pour lesquelles l'autorisation d'utiliser la fonctionnalité est accordée. Voir
Permissions-Policy> Syntaxe pour plus de détails.
Règle par défaut
La liste d'autorisations par défaut pour payment est self.
Spécifications
| Spécification |
|---|
| Payment Request API> # permissions-policy> |
Compatibilité des navigateurs
Voir aussi
- L'en-tête
Permissions-Policy - Politique de permissions